Average Eavestrough Cleaning Cost in Lethbridge
So what’s the typical price range? Here’s what you can expect:
Small bungalow: Average Cost $100–4150
Mid size Home: $150–$250
Large Custom Home: $250–$350
These are approximations, by the way. Accessibility, roof slope, trash accumulation, and house size can all have an impact on your final cost.
The cost can be higher if your gutters need minor repairs or haven’t been cleaned in years. However, this is a very little expenditure when compared to the cost of water damage repairs.
What Factors Affect the Cost?
1. Size and Height of the Home
Taller homes require more time, tools, and safety measures, which increases the cost.
2. Amount of Debris
If your eavestroughs are packed with years of buildup, the cleaning process becomes longer and more labor-intensive.
3. Condition and Repairs
The total cost may increase if gutters that are drooping, cracked, or pulling away from the house require more repairs.

Is It Really Worth the Cost?
YES—and here’s why.
Let’s deconstruct it:
Avoids High-Cost Water Damage
Water spilling over clogged gutters can harm your siding, rot your fascia, or seep into your basement. These repairs can cost, depending on severity.
Protects Your Roof
Standing water in blocked gutters leads to ice damming in winter and roof rot in warmer months. A simple $150 cleaning avoids costly roof repairs.
Keeps Pests Away
Clogged eavestroughs are ideal homes for mosquitoes, rodents, and birds. Regular cleaning eliminates nesting spots.
Increases the Value of a House
A well-maintained home is demonstrated to potential buyers by a clean and functional eavestrough. This is a simple curb appeal boost if you intend to sell.
